Abstract
The utility model provides a quick installation type automobile front shock absorber supporting structure which comprises an automobile body front shock absorber installation seat (2) and a shock absorber (3). The shock absorber (3) comprises a shock absorber upper support (4) and a shock absorber telescopic rod (7). A concave groove is formed in the front end of the shock absorber upper support (4), and the end face (41) of the shock absorber upper support (4) is in contact with the automobile body front shock absorber installation seat (2). The concave groove penetrates through the automobile body front shock absorber installation seat (2), and a buckle device (1) is arranged in the concave groove. The buckle device (1) is formed by connecting and clamping a first buckle (11) and a second buckle (12) in a butting joint mode. The shock absorber upper support is connected with the shock absorber telescopic rod, and the shock absorber upper support is arranged in an automobile body front suspension installation seat and then is fixed by the buckle device. The buckle device is locked by teeth, the teeth just need to be clamped in tooth grooves in the installing process, and assembling efficiency of the shock absorber supporting structure is much higher than traditional bolt connection.
Description
Technical field
The utility model relates to a kind of automobile absorber supporting construction, particularly relates to a kind of fast-assembling type front shock absorber of automobile structure.
Background technology
The hinged effect of bumper is, upper end is fixedly connected with vehicle body, and lower end is connected with absorber rod, and it has following task and performance: the production tolerance of compensation vehicle bridge; Can there is universal angle flexibility, so that counter torque is as much as possible little; Within the scope of overall vehicle bridge kinematics, possesses elastokinematics performance.
On traditional automobile absorber, support with vehicle body and be bolted, it is longer on fitting line, to complete the man-hour that the connection mode of bolt needs, and needs to design aliging of bolt that corresponding location feature guarantee bumper guarantees in the time that vehicle body is combined and bolt hole simultaneously.
In recent years, along with the requirement of auto production line efficiency is more and more higher, need to improve constantly the degree of automation of fitting line, also need structurally to adopt some fast-assembling type designs.The utility model designs a kind of fast-assembling type automobile absorber supporting construction exactly, improves the efficiency of assembling of bumper.

The specific embodiment
Below in conjunction with drawings and Examples, the utility model is described in further detail.
Referring to Fig. 1, Fig. 2 and Fig. 3, bumper 3 comprise on bumper, support 4 with bumper expansion link 7, on bumper, support 4 and be connected with bumper expansion link 7, on bumper, support 4 front end and be provided with Baltimore groove.Preferably, Baltimore groove is concave circular arcs groove 42, on bumper, supporting 4 end face 41 contacts with vehicle body front shock absorber mount pad 2, concave circular arcs groove 42 is through being equipped with bayonet unit 1 in vehicle body front shock absorber mount pad 2 and concave circular arcs groove 42, and bayonet unit 1 docks buckle by the first buckle 11 with the second buckle 12 and forms.
Particularly, the first buckle 11 has tooth 5, the second buckles 12 and is provided with teeth groove 6, and tooth 5 snaps in diametrically teeth groove 6 and keeps locking.
Referring to Fig. 1, Fig. 2 and Fig. 3, the end face 41 supporting on bumper in the structure of having assembled in 4 contacts with vehicle body front shock absorber mount pad 2, and bayonet unit is presented axially in the concave circular arcs groove 42 that supports 4 on bumper.
In fitting process, first bumper 3 is packed into and put into vehicle body front shock absorber mount pad 2, then the first buckle 11 and the second buckle 12 are snapped in the concave circular arcs groove 42 that supports 4 on bumper according to the mode in Fig. 3.
As shown in Figure 3, the first buckle 11 has tooth 5, the second buckles 12 and is provided with teeth groove 6 bayonet unit 1, and tooth 5 snaps in diametrically teeth groove 6 and keeps locking.Bayonet unit 1 can limit the up-and-down movement of bumper 3, and keeps radial direction locking.
